Output f27fb6896cbfe608a48e9623f42698322139c86a9d9139e3d30fb1ff5c04e7a9:0

value
98668867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8551066541f89b6e15ec0977b41ed88450430d66 OP_EQUAL
address
3DqvrmiCV8nuD8FNmATGuA2enSx8QAaMNp
transaction
f27fb6896cbfe608a48e9623f42698322139c86a9d9139e3d30fb1ff5c04e7a9
spent
true